JOHANNESBURG - A suspect connected to a drug laboratory in Vanderbijlpark in Gauteng is set to appear in court soon.

The 46-year-old man was arrested this past Friday following a search conducted at a property in South Crest, Alberton.

During the operation, police discovered 7,000 mandrax pills, valued at over half a million rand.

Police spokesperson Amanda van Wyk says their tactical teams successfully traced the whereabouts of the fully operational drug laboratory.

"Further investigations led the team to a property in Vanderbijlpark, where they uncovered a fully operational drug laboratory. Seized items included a tablet press, various chemicals, drug manufacturing equipment, and a quantity of mandrax powder and mandrax tablets with an estimated value of R500 000."
